The dimensions of two components have to fit together in the joined area. The inner part is the  bore  , the outer part the  shaft  . Because of the choice of the tolerance classes of bore and shaft, either a  positive allowance  or  negative allowance  is the result. The difference between the dimensions of the bore and the shaft specifies the fit. There are three types of fit: Loose fit The minimum size limit of the bore is always larger; in a  limit case  , it is equal to the maximum size limit of the shaft. Medium fit Depending on the actual size of bore and shaft, the  result  at joining is either a positive allowance or negative allowance. Interference fit The  maximum  size limit of the bore is always smaller; in a limit case, it is equal to the minimum size limit of the shaft. Work in groups of three.
